Phytophthora rot developed on blanched stem of udo in the temperature range of 10 to 30°C, with the optimum temperature at 20°C and the second best at 15 or 18°C. Sclerotinia rot developed at 10 to 25°C with the optimum temperature being 20°C and southern blight developed at 15 to 35°C, with the optimum temperature at 25°C. The optimum temperature on the development of Phytophthora rot and Sclerotinia rot obtained by artificial inoculation test agreed with the optimum room temperature in blanching culture.
